Joen Wolfrom Workshop Vacancies: Book now!

There are three vacancies in the upcoming workshop with Joen Wolfrom.  Joen is a well known U.S. Quilter and Author of many books (available in the Guild’s library) This is a one-off opportunity to learn from Joen and we are very lucky to be able to take advantage of Joen’s Barbara Meredith Foundation funded trip to Australia.

Lighting up your quilts...a colour workshop

Saturday and Sunday, 10-11 October 2015
Cnr Phyllis and Central Avenues, Thornleigh

Full payment must be made when booking. Cost $130 members and $200 non-members.  Download and return a Workshop Booking Form or call the Guild office on 9283 3737 to reserve your place!

One of Joen’s specialties is teaching about colour and she tells us this is her favourite short colour workshop. In this techniques workshop you will be presented with important colour basics, so that the world of colour is in your hands. Then you will learn how to create some of the most wonderful colour illusions, depth, luminosity and luster. Explore further the illusions of shadows, highlights, and transparency. You should leave the class with a wide array of evocative lighting ideas to use in your future quilts.

Singleton Quilters Inc. 2015 Quilt Exhibition: 18 - 20 September 2015

The Singleton Quilters Inc. will be holding a Quilt Exhibition at The Mechanics Institute, 74 George Street, Singleton on Friday 18, Saturday 19 and Sunday 20 September 2015 from 10am to 4pm (Sunday 10am to 3pm).


This year our Club chose ‘Tall Poppies’ as our theme to pay tribute to the Australian men and women who were involved in World War 1, one century ago this year. We also pay tribute to the achievements and friendship of our quilting group and the wider quilting community.
